pick somebody’s pocket (verb)
Giải nghĩa:
To steal from someone's pocket without them noticing.
Ví dụ:
While I was on the crowded subway, someone picked my pocket.
pick somebody’s pocket (verb)
Giải nghĩa:
To exploit or take advantage of someone in a dishonest or unfair way.
Ví dụ:
Many people feel that the company has been picking their pockets with its high prices.
